What is the difference between Decavac and Tenivac?

TENIVAC vaccine pricing will be the same as DECAVAC vaccine. Shipping of TENIVAC vaccine began March 1, 2012. While TENIVAC vaccine will be the only Td vaccine offered by Sanofi Pasteur, DECAVAC will remain in the market through McKesson until DECAVAC vaccine inventory is depleted.

What is the difference between Tenivac and TdVax?

A major difference is Tenivac contains latex in the caps of the prefilled syringes, whereas TdVax is latex-free.

What is Tenivac vaccine for?

TENIVAC® is a vaccine indicated for active immunization for the prevention of tetanus and diphtheria in persons 7 years of age and older. In persons who have not been immunized previously against tetanus and diphtheria, primary immunization with TENIVAC consists of three 0.5 mL doses.

Does Tenivac contain thimerosal?

The vaccine contains a trace amount of thimerosal (not as a preservative) from the manufacturing process [≤0.3 micrograms (μg) mercury/dose]. There are two Td vaccines used in the United States: Tenivac® and a generic.

Do adults need Tdap booster?

Every adult should get a Tdap vaccine once if they did not receive it as an adolescent to protect against pertussis (whooping cough), and then a Td (tetanus, diphtheria) or Tdap booster shot every 10 years. In addition, women should get the Tdap vaccine each time they are pregnant, preferably at 27 through 36 weeks.

How long is a Tdap vaccine good for?

Studies estimate that diphtheria toxoid-containing vaccines protect nearly all people (95 in 100) for approximately 10 years. Protection decreases over time, so adults need to get a Td or Tdap booster shot every 10 years to stay protected.

Can you get Td and Tdap together?

There are no contraindications to the co-administration of diphtheria, tetanus, and pertussis vaccines. You may administer DTaP, DT, Td, and Tdap with other indicated vaccines during the same visit. However, administer each vaccine using a separate syringe and, if possible, at a different anatomic site.

What is the difference between DTaP Tdap and Td?

Vaccines used today against diphtheria and tetanus (i.e., DT and Td) sometimes also include protection against whooping cough or pertussis (i.e., DTaP and Tdap). Babies and children younger than 7 years old receive DTaP or DT, while older children and adults receive Tdap and Td.
